Develop and review comprehensive technical reports, ensuring clarity, accuracy, and actionable recommendations for clients and stakeholders.
Support business development by preparing proposals and participating in client meetings regularly.
Visit client sites to educate clients on facility siting methodology and perform onsite activities (e.g., scenario development, congestion assessments)
Serve as the primary technical contact for clients, presenting findings and guiding risk mitigation strategies.
Stay abreast of evolving regulations, standards, and modeling technologies in facility siting and process safety, and drive continuous improvement initiatives.
Stay current with industry trends, best practices, and emerging technologies in facility siting and risk assessment reports, invoice approvals, and collections status notices promptly by Company procedures.
Mentor and provide technical guidance to junior engineers, fostering professional development within the team.
Interpret and apply relevant codes, standards, and regulations (e.g., API 752/753, OSHA PSM, NFPA).
Oversee and execute advanced hazard analyses for dispersion (flammable/toxic), explosion, and fire scenarios using available software tools.

The company was established in 1971 as a technical advisory arm of a marine classification society.
.originally focused on marine and offshore services, it expanded across industrial manufacturing, oil, gas, chemicals, energy, government, life sciences and LNG sectors.
headquartered in Spring, Texas, the firm operates globally, delivering data-driven solutions to secure critical assets and operations.
typical projects include process safety management, integrity assurance, asset reliability programs, certification services and digital risk analytics.
their work spans high-stakes industries—from offshore vessel inspections to LNG facility maintenance and governmental risk management.
with heritage rooted in marine classification since 1971, they uniquely blend classification-grade rigor with modern analytics.
they’re notable for pioneering maritime cybersecurity, AI-enhanced inspections and software solutions like fleet management platforms.
